The spool ball of the floating ball valve moves between the two seat sealing rings with the help of medium pressure, while the spool ball of the trunnion mounted ball valve is connected with the valve stem and rotates around the center of the valve stem, and the floating seat support ring. In steam and condensate systems, garbage and debris in pipelines often cause damage to equipment, such as scale, rust, welding slag, and other solid particles, which may enter the pipeline system. Strainers can filter out solid particles in liquids or gases, not only protecting equipment from damage, but also reducing equipment downtime and maintenance time. 1. Non rising stem gate valve: The stem nut is located inside the valve body and in direct contact with the medium. When opening and closing the gate, rotate the valve stem to achieve this. Y-type filters are widely utilized across various industrial sectors, including petroleum, chemicals, pharmaceuticals, food processing, water treatment, and more. These filters effectively remove impurities and particulate matter from fluids, safeguarding downstream equipment from contamination and damage while enhancing product quality and production efficiency.
